The Sickness comic books issue 1

  • Issue #1A
    Sickness (2023 Uncivilized Comics) 1A

    This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.

    Written by Jenna Cha, Lonnie Nadler. Art and Cover by Jenna Cha. Feeling sick? The Man may be following you… 1945: Daniel Buss, an anxious teenager living in small-town America, has been experiencing strange symptoms: mood swings, increased sensitivity, and terrifying hallucinations, threatening to ruin his summer vacation before freshman year. Worse, a stalking presence watches Daniel's every move. 1955: George Brooks-war vet and tireless doctor-nears retirement from his decorated past. When a local housewife murders her entire family, her son-the sole survivor-is put into his care; George grows obsessed with uncovering what could drive an ordinary person to such brutality. Though they live a decade apart, their fates intertwine through a horrifying illness and the haunting figure who follows wherever they go. 32 pages, full B&W. Cover price $6.00.

  • Issue #1-1ST
    Sickness in the Family HC (2010 DC/Vertigo) 1-1ST

    1st printing.

    Written by DENISE MINA. Art by ANTONIO FUSO. Cover by LEE BERMEJO.

    Denise Mina, award-winning crime novelist, brings her psychological style of crime fiction to Vertigo Crime.

    Meet the Ushers.

    The parents, Ted and Biddy. Grandma Martha. The three kids, William, Amy and Sam. Just a normal, middle-class family gathered around the table on Christmas Day. Until they start dying. Violent deaths. One by one. Is there a curse on their house, as a recently unearthed history of witchcraft in the area would suggest? Or has one member of the Usher clan declared open season on the rest? As secrets and resentments boil to the surface, it becomes clear that more than one Usher has a motive for killing off the others. But in the end, the truth turns out to be far more shocking than anyone in this ill-fated family could have imagined.

    Hardcover, 5 1/2-in. x 8-in., 192 pages, B&W. MATURE READERS

    Cover price $19.99.

  • Issue #1-1ST
    Sickness Unto Death GN (2013 Vertical Digest) 1-1ST

    Volume 1 - 1st printing. By Takahiro Seguchi. Based on the book by Danish philosopher Soren Kierkegaard, Seguchi's Sickness Unto Death is a modern fictional retelling of his concepts of despair, sin, and self-image. At 18, Futaba Kazuma is going to college to get his certification in clinical psychology. While attending school, he boards at a creepy mansion. Also living there is a strange young woman called Emiru. She suffers from a terminal illness of the heart - despair. This deep psychological problem has eerie physical effects as well: her hair has turned white, her body temperature is well below normal, and her blood pressure is also bizarre. No psychologists or counselors have been able to help cure her of this problem. Will Kazuma be able to determine the cause of Emiru's despair and save her before it's too late? Softcover, 208 pages, B&W. NOTE: These are Japanese manga-style GNs and are meant to be read right-to-left. Cover price $11.95.
